I wouldn't bother fermenting the liver... it will just smell.I'm formulating a new homemade feed, but I'm not sure if it can be fermented. The protein source in the feed will be dehydrated beef liver. Can small pieces of meat go into the FF?
The feed would be
50 lbs wheat
50 lbs oats
8 lbs dried liver
1/2 lb trace mineral salt
I know most commercial feed uses fish meal or bone meal, and this shouldn't be *that* different. I guess another option would be to puree fresh liver and mix it into the fermented grains before feeding.
I wouldn't bother fermenting the liver... it will just smell.
I add several different animal protein sources and just add them daily to my ff just prior to feeding.
Also... if you reduce your oats and wheat to 40lbs each and add 10 lbs of field peas, that will bring your protein up to 16.2%... a better protein amount for layers than the 15.2% the above ration provides.
Or increasing your liver to 12 lbs (hydrated) would put you just over 16% at 16.1%
For chicks or meat chickens an even greater protein increase is needed... and calcium and limestone added according to management group also (since you wouldn't want the added calcium for chicks)... but guessing you already knew that and this is just your base ration for all management groups...
